## Authentication

As of Quillpay v4, payroll exports use the new columnar format, and the legacy CSV endpoint has been retired. Plugins must authenticate against the Ledgerbridge internal service before requesting an export batch. Requests without valid credentials return a 401 with no retry hint. Scopes are granted per plugin at registration time. Include the following key in the X-Quillpay-Auth header on every request.

API key for tagef-fafop: vxb2-ta

Subject: DR drill next Thursday — tile prefetcher failover

Hello plugin authors,

Next Thursday we'll run a disaster-recovery drill on the Wayfarer map-tile prefetcher. Primary tile storage will be taken offline for two hours; plugins should fall back to the warm replica automatically. Please verify your plugin handles prefetch cache misses gracefully and doesn't hammer the replica with retries. During the drill, the sandbox replica console will be locked; if you need access, authenticate with the passphrase below.

unlock words, hahip-baduf: holwyn-istath-julvan

## Formula sandbox tuning

User-supplied formulas in Gridmoor execute inside a restricted interpreter with hard ceilings on time, memory, and call depth. Reviewers should confirm any change to these ceilings is justified in the PR description, since raising them widens the abuse surface. Defaults were chosen from production traces. The current limits are as follows.

limits module of tafog-fawip:
WEIGHTS = {
    "julix": 57,
    "lamys": 992,
    "kasvan": 209,
    "quenok": 750,
    "alddor": 259,
    "oliath": 1009,
    "wenix": 815,
}

**Handover — Tilecast Prefetcher (from Renna to Oskar)**

Plugin authors hook into the prefetch queue via the manifest, not the scheduler — the scheduler API is internal and will change. Current prefetch radius is 2 zoom levels; anything wider thrashes the cache. Eviction is LRU with a 400 MB cap. If the worker pool wedges, restart it from the admin shell and unlock the state store with the passphrase below.

vault phrase of kawep-tahog = ulaix-briath